>>> This patch doesn't touch NTID since it seems very difficult (or
>>> impossible) to generate. Seemingly because the state tracker or glsl
>>> compiler is turning gl_WorkGroupSize into a immediate. Such a
>>> transformation is not possible with GL_ARB_compute_variable_group_size
>>> but gl_WorkGroupSize is not available when that extension is enabled.
>>>
>>> On Kepler+, it seems to end up being lowered into constant buffer loads anyway.

>>>> Instead of combining SV_TID reads into a SV_COMBINED_TID read, this has
>>>> SV_TID reads lowered into a SV_COMBINED_TID read which can them be
>>>> combined by CSE and then turned into a SV_TID read by AlgebraicOpt if it
>>>> doesn't create another RDSV.

>>>> diff --git a/src/gallium/drivers/nouveau/codegen/nv50_ir_lowering_nvc0.cpp b/src/gallium/drivers/nouveau/codegen/nv50_ir_lowering_nvc0.cpp
>>>> index 597dcdffbe..1410cf26c8 100644
>>>> --- a/src/gallium/drivers/nouveau/codegen/nv50_ir_lowering_nvc0.cpp
>>>> +++ b/src/gallium/drivers/nouveau/codegen/nv50_ir_lowering_nvc0.cpp
>>>> @@ -2576,6 +2576,18 @@ NVC0LoweringPass::handleRDSV(Instruction *i)
>>>>           // TGSI backend may use 4th component of TID,NTID,CTAID,NCTAID
>>>>           i->op = OP_MOV;
>>>>           i->setSrc(0, bld.mkImm((sv == SV_NTID || sv == SV_NCTAID) ? 1 : 0));
>>>> +      } else
>>>> +      if (sv == SV_TID) {
>>>> +         // Help CSE combine TID fetches
>>>> +         Value *tid = bld.mkOp1v(OP_RDSV, TYPE_U32, bld.getScratch(),
>>>> +                                 bld.mkSysVal(SV_COMBINED_TID, 0));
>>>> +         i->op = OP_EXTBF;
>>>> +         i->setSrc(0, tid);
>>>> +         switch (sym->reg.data.sv.index) {
>>>> +         case 0: i->setSrc(1, bld.mkImm(0x1000)); break;
>>>> +         case 1: i->setSrc(1, bld.mkImm(0x0a10)); break;
>>>> +         case 2: i->setSrc(1, bld.mkImm(0x061a)); break;
>>>> +         }
>>>>        }
